The foreclosure pipeline has 4 Million homes. These home owners are in foreclosure or are 90 days delinquent or more.
Foreclosure Starts fell below 200,000 which is a 31 percent drop (from March to April). This is a drop of 14.7 percent from last year.
It's a good sign that foreclosure starts are on the decline, especially since the foreclosure pipeline is already so very bloated.
